Output 3604f830c14c5bb9f820af86ae7cfc2ba5dd11f8c561d2c53969045a24c47f0f:1

value
2000836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4d606e796adbf48eca7af19becb4865220b8539 OP_EQUAL
address
3Gib8rkcfhtPjt2zxaUeZvrmxePGbvbd2g
transaction
3604f830c14c5bb9f820af86ae7cfc2ba5dd11f8c561d2c53969045a24c47f0f
confirmations
385173
spent
true